You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@juddi.apache.org by al...@apache.org on 2015/10/29 00:16:13 UTC
juddi git commit: JUDDI-939 fixing a potential NPE with a more user
friendly error message
Repository: juddi
Updated Branches:
refs/heads/master 0c3ac4f1e -> bbf1cccd6
JUDDI-939 fixing a potential NPE with a more user friendly error message
Project: http://git-wip-us.apache.org/repos/asf/juddi/repo
Commit: http://git-wip-us.apache.org/repos/asf/juddi/commit/bbf1cccd
Tree: http://git-wip-us.apache.org/repos/asf/juddi/tree/bbf1cccd
Diff: http://git-wip-us.apache.org/repos/asf/juddi/diff/bbf1cccd
Branch: refs/heads/master
Commit: bbf1cccd63a65593b023bb35a5f3da4576c9437f
Parents: 0c3ac4f
Author: Alex <al...@apache.org>
Authored: Wed Oct 28 19:16:08 2015 -0400
Committer: Alex <al...@apache.org>
Committed: Wed Oct 28 19:16:08 2015 -0400
----------------------------------------------------------------------
.../main/java/org/apache/juddi/v3/client/config/UDDIClient.java | 3 +++
1 file changed, 3 insertions(+)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/juddi/blob/bbf1cccd/juddi-client/src/main/java/org/apache/juddi/v3/client/config/UDDIClient.java
----------------------------------------------------------------------
diff --git a/juddi-client/src/main/java/org/apache/juddi/v3/client/config/UDDIClient.java b/juddi-client/src/main/java/org/apache/juddi/v3/client/config/UDDIClient.java
index 0c9e7d7..e7b83e5 100644
--- a/juddi-client/src/main/java/org/apache/juddi/v3/client/config/UDDIClient.java
+++ b/juddi-client/src/main/java/org/apache/juddi/v3/client/config/UDDIClient.java
@@ -134,6 +134,9 @@ public class UDDIClient {
*/
public synchronized ServiceLocator getServiceLocator(String clerkName) throws ConfigurationException {
UDDIClerk clerk = getClerk(clerkName);
+ if (clerk==null){
+ throw new ConfigurationException("could not locate the UDDI Clerk '" + clerkName +"'.");
+ }
if (!serviceLocators.containsKey(clerk.getName())) {
ServiceLocator serviceLocator = new ServiceLocator(clerk, new URLLocalizerDefaultImpl(), properties);
serviceLocators.put(clerk.getName(), serviceLocator);
---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@juddi.apache.org
For additional commands, e-mail: commits-help@juddi.apache.org